So by looking at your pictures, it appears that there is no resonator on the B pipe. Is that correct? That must be one D@MN loud a$s exhaust system. No wonder you have to cruise in 6th on the streets.

So you decided to go with the "over the axle" exhaust instead of the "under the axle" exhaust? Or, was that the only option for the RSX?

yep..no resonator..sounds good though..no killer bee sound.
and uh yeah..thats just how the piping is for the DC5 application..i had no choice in that =P ..if i recall correctly..most exhaust installs weve done at our shop have been "over-axle" as you refer to it as...
